2016-04-03 61 views
0

我正在制作一个LibGDX的小游戏,对于这个游戏,我需要一个小容器,这是一个scene2D Stack,并且该容器内部是一个标签。LibGDX如何让scene2D通知标签在容器内滚动

我的问题是,这个标签可能只在一行上,如果标签文本比容器宽度长,那么它必须从右向左缓慢移动/滚动,这样玩家可以看到整个通知文本。当所有文字都显示出来后,滑动应该重新开始。

我可以想出,对于行为的最好例子,就像下面

希望任何人图像中的数字文本标志有一些导游或者可以告诉我一些代码,得到我去:)

Digital Text Sign

回答

0

如果是我,我想创建一个表(标签的容器)和标签(文本),并相应地改变标签的位置,然后重新设置。尊重所有的label.getwidth等

+0

但是,如何隐藏一些标签文本,当它滚动出容器范围? – Rohwedder

+0

就像我在Facebook上所说的那样,使用一个窗口来隐藏外部文本,但对于那些偶然发现的人来说,只需使用一个窗口:3和平 – Vandrake